How to Choose Data in Yujaa?

The first step to begin the guided tour with Yujaa is to choose a data. The whole process of determining required data with Yujaa is easy. You can select the ‘Choose Your Data’ option from the Yujaa homepage to avail the pre-built data connectors types and develop a data connection for the variety of data connectors.

Yujaa offers categories for various domains such as Cloud Storage, Databases, E-commerce, File, Finance, Project Management and so on to create a data connector. The video provided here explains steps to create the Google Sheet Data Connector at length. Have a look at the same through the following explanation.

Click the ‘Choose Your Data’ option from the Yujaa homepage. Select the ‘Google Sheet’ connector and click ‘Connect’ to establish a connection.

Users will be redirected to add a Google Sheet account via the ‘CREDENTIALS’ tab. Users can also select an account if the settings for the account are configured in advance.

By selecting the ‘Add New Account’ option, users will be redirected to Sign In and allow Yujaa to access data from their selected Google account.

After configuring the Google account users will be taken back to the Google Sheet Data Connection page to provide a name for the new data connector. Use ‘NEXT’ option to proceed towards the subsequent page.

Now, users will be redirected to the ‘Data Sets’ tab to select a file from the drop-down menu and avail data preview through the ‘PREVIEW’ option. In case, if the file has multiple sheets, users need to select a specific sheet by using the ‘Select Sheet’ option.

The data overview/preview of the fetched data can only be displayed after selecting a specific sheet. The ‘FINISH’ option can be accessed from the bottom of the data overview to complete the connector creation process as explained in the video.

By completing the process as mentioned above, users will be notified by a message that a new data connection has been created successfully. The newly formed Google Sheet connection will be added to the ‘List Data Sets’ page displaying the ‘GENERAL INFORMATION’ about the same on the right-side panel.

To check the data loading status of the newly created dataset click ‘Notification’ option from the Yujaa homepage.

After the data is loaded successfully to the newly created data connection, users can create multiple reports and dashboards based on the newly created data connector.
